Managing Nematodirus risk this spring

Nematodirus battus is a species of gastrointestinal worm that can cause scour, reduced growth rates and even death in naïve young lambs.ÌýIt is the immature (non-egg producing) stages of the worm which cause disease; therefore,Ìýworm egg counts are not a useful tool in predicting and preventing losses due toÌýNematodirus.Ìý

The patterns of disease and infection withÌýNematodirusÌýare changing due to evolution of the parasite in the UK climate, and with the warming global climate.ÌýWe are increasingly seeing peaks inÌýNematodirusÌýegg output from lambs in both spring and autumn.ÌýPastures which carried lambs last spring are at greatest risk, and holding lambs off these fields until later in the summer can reduce infections.ÌýÌý

However, even pastures which carried lambs in the previous autumn (18 months ago) cannot be considered reliably ‘clean’.ÌýMost eggs will lie dormant low down in the grass, or in the soil until the following spring, and so grazing adult animals or cows over these pastures will not reduce the risk ofÌýNematodirusÌýas the eggs are not consumed (but grazing will still help reduce the pasture burdens of other worms).ÌýAlso, ensiling a paddock does not reduce the risk ofÌýNematodirusÌýthe following year for the same reason. Ìý

Fields where lambs were grazed last year are likely to have aÌýnematodirusÌýlarval challenge over the next month or so. The timing and impact of theÌýNematodirusÌýhatch is individual to the field and the age of lambs grazing it.ÌýMarch born lambs are likely to be ingesting sufficient grass to be at risk of acuteÌýNematodirusÌýon contaminated pastures.ÌýIn later lambing flocks, where lambs are not ingesting significant amounts of grass yet, the ewe’s may ‘clean’ the pastureÌýsomewhat asÌýthey graze, leading to a lesser risk of acuteÌýNematodirosisÌýin these lambs.ÌýÌý

The free SCOPS Nematodirus forecast is available on the and provides an indication of the risk of disease due to Nematodirus in areas across the UK. Local conditions on your own farm should be considered as the hatch will be later on more elevated fields and those with a northerly aspect.ÌýÌý

The risk of nematodirus will increase when the air temperature exceeds 11.5 °CÌýfor seven days and hatching of eggs on the pasture takes place.ÌýAfter hatching, larvae usually only survive forÌýone to twoÌýmonths on the pasture before dying.ÌýThe majority ofÌýNematodirusÌýdiagnoses made by ÒÁÈËÖ±²¥ in Scotland fall in the months of May and June, usually in 6-12-week-old lambs.Ìý

Lambs withÌýNematodirosisÌýoften have scour and appear empty, although disease can occur suddenly with several deaths in aÌý24-hourÌýperiod sometimes with little scour noted in the group.ÌýÌý

Timing drenching forÌýNematodirusÌýto coincide with the risk period is critical. Fixed time drenching (still common on many farms) may miss the risk period, occurring too early in a cold spring or too late in a warm one.Ìý Ìý

5 top tipsÌý

  1. Assess whether the pasture is likely to have a NematodirusÌýburden. Ìý
  2. Use SCOPS forecast to predict timing of the hatch on your farm. Ìý
  3. Assess if the hatch on your field/farm will likely coincide with when lambs are eating a significant amount of grass (6-12 weeks, younger if ewes are not milking well). Ìý
  4. Time treatment strategically to coincide with the period of risk. Ìý
  5. Investigate apparent treatment failure with worm/cocci egg counts or post-mortem examinations.Ìý
